  • Let’s continue pre-bussing as this is a major hospitality point, but it also assists the dishwashers & helps them stay ahead of the flow of dishes rather than running out of clean dishes for service. Pre-bussing also assists in faster table resets so we can decrease our wait times. Pre-bussing needs to be getting done at every table, every single time - especially with busier summer times coming up.
